    In this episode, we explore why we feel pressured to explain our healing, boundaries, and need for space, and why we don’t owe anyone a detailed justification. We’ll unpack how upbringing can teach us that our “no” must be approved, how women’s choices are often questioned more than men’s, and how additional scrutiny can show up for women of color, pushing us into overexplaining to be believed. Then we’ll cover how overexplaining keeps us stuck seeking validation, gives unsafe people access to our story, centers others’ comfort over our healing, and drains our energy.     In this episode, we are joined by Dr. Rachna Buxani, a therapist and author who specializes in anxiety, depression, relationship challenges, and narcissistic abuse treatment, about the kind of subtle, hard-to-name pain that can exist in family and romantic relationships. We discuss what shifts when someone finally validates their experience (anger, grief, sadness, and self-compassion), how to hold both love and harm as true, and why disengaging from a parent or family member is often a long, painful decision shaped by guilt and social pressure. Dr. Buxani explains how survival strategies can get mistaken for personality traits, how these wounds show up later as people-pleasing and reactivity, and why healing doesn’t require confrontation or forgiveness, often it’s quiet, internal work.
